In a conversation with Vanity Fair, the actor expressed how the show helped him make his way in the industry. He said,

“The role that changed my life was in Game of Thrones. I will always credit its creators for taking a chance on someone who had nothing but unknown theater credits and episodic television on their résumé. I am still in awe at the opportunity that was handed to me by David Benioff, Dan Weiss, and Carolyn Strauss. Without Thrones, I would not have had Narcos, The Mandalorian, or The Last of Us.”

Before fans see him don the iconic blue uniform for Fantastic Four, we will see in the sequel to Gladiator which is set to release this year. Paul Mescal and Denzel Washington headline the movie with Pascal in an undisclosed role. He recounted his experience on set with the director Ridley Scott,

“I’ve been a part of big sets where the identity of the project, in a sense, is its size—and still, I have not been on a set as impressive as Gladiator’s. [Director] Ridley [Scott] leaves very little to the imagination in the most old-fashioned sense. All the players and pieces are there on the day, and suddenly the expected challenge of believing yourself as a powerful person in the era of the Roman Empire is evaporated.”
